Who does ZandKade Compliance work for?

All institutions subject to the Dutch AML Act (Wwft): banks, payment service providers, trust offices, crypto-asset service providers, accountants, tax advisors, civil-law notaries, lawyers, real estate agents and dealers — as well as foreign firms entering the Dutch market.
